Anytime you participate in online shopping, you should always be on the lookout for coupon codes. Many stores provide discounts for everything from shipping to a percentage off your order, and these can be found with a simple Google search. Type the store or item name you are looking for a coupon for and browse the results. When you do this, you can save lots of money shopping online.
When looking over a new online retailer, read over their terms and conditions and privacy policy. These things include their collected information, the manner in which they protect this information, and the conditions you must agree to whenever you purchase one of their products. If there are any terms you are not comfortable with, do not purchase anything without contacting the merchant. If you do not agree with their policies, do not buy from them.

It is important that you only shop on a secure connection, so do so from home if this has been set up properly. Hackers seek out connections that are not secure when they are on the lookout for victims.
If you are overpaying for shipping, try using standard shipping instead of expedited shipping. Items that are shipped at standard rates often make their way to homes pretty quickly. Exercising a little patience could pay off in a big way!
If you frequent a particular online store, create an account with them. Many retailers will send their registered customers discount offers. Registering also makes check out easier. You can opt in to receiving information about their deals in your email inbox. You can also return items easier and track your orders if you have an account.
When you shop on the Internet, try to wait until the holidays to buy things you don’t need. Some holidays are known for their terrific sales, and online retailers tend to follow this custom. Holiday shoppers can often get discounts, free shipping and other savings by shopping during certain sales times.
